Getting from Mazatlan International Airport (MZT) to central Mazatlan
Mazatlan International Airport to the centre of Mazatlan has a drive time of about 25 minutes. It's approximately 23 kilometres away.
When to fly to Mazatlan International Airport (MZT)
It's time to pick your dates for your flight from Penticton Airport to Mazatlan International Airport. March is the most popular month to head to Mazatlan. If you prefer a more low-key vibe, go in May.
The warmest month in Mazatlan is July, with temperatures ranging between 25ºC and 33ºC. Book your flights from Penticton Airport to Mazatlan International Airport in this month if you like this kind of weather.
January sees average temperatures of between 16ºC and 27ºC. Look for cheap tickets from YYF to MZT sometime around then if you like travelling in cooler conditions.
